Highlight Verse:

“He said to me, “Son of man, watch and listen. Pay close attention to everything I show you. You have been brought here so I can show you many things. Then you will return to the people of Israel and tell them everything you have seen.””
‭‭Ezekiel‬ ‭40‬:‭4‬ ‭NLT‬‬

When the Bible says to pay close attention, my mind goes, “Oh, maybe I should pay close attention here.”

In all seriousness, sentences like this grab my attention and I brace for something mind blowing.

And then we get a detailed description of a temple.

Some say the description was figurative. But why would God spend the next nine chapters in detailed description if it was just figurative.

Some say it describes the temple as it will be in heaven. I have a hard time with that because I believe we will be in the direct presence of God. Why would we need a temple and priests?

Others say it was meant as plans for the temple and the land for the Israelites when they returned to the land.

You could say that’s not true because the Israelites did not follow those instructions.

But then, how many times have we not followed the detailed instructions of God to the letter?

Maybe it would be easier to ask how many times we did follow God’s instructions.

Ezekiel paid close attention and wrote the descriptions down in great detail.

The people heard the instructions and rebuilt the temple and the nation their own way.

Life could have been much different if they had followed the instructions.
